jPDFPrint is a Java library that enables direct printing of PDF documents from Java or web applications, with or without user intervention. The library is capable of loading and printing PDFs to any printer.

One of the best things about jPDFPrint is that it is built on top of Qoppa's proprietary PDF technology. This means that you don't have to worry about installing any third party software or drivers. Plus, since it is written in Java, your application will remain platform independent, running on various platforms like Windows, Linux, Unix (Solaris, HP UX, IBM AIX), Mac OS X and more.
The library offers an impressive range of features such as printing any PDF document, printing with or without user intervention (silent print), and support for the latest PDF format. With flexible printing options, you can customize the printing process to fit your specific needs.
One more thing, jPDFPrint runs on Java 6 and above, and doesn't require any third party software or drivers for it to work. You can start using the library right away, without the need for add-ons or extensions.
In conclusion, if you're looking to print PDF documents seamlessly from your Java application, then jPDFPrint is your go-to solution. For additional information, feel free to contact the team at [email protected].
Version 2021R1:
Java 9 Support
Rich Text and Non-Latin Unicode Support in Form Fields